A very special welcome to the first edition of "The Outsourcer," the Asia Pacific's landmark online magazine to specifically address the benefits and challenges of outsourcing and off-shoring. Collectively known as Business Process Outsourcing (BPO). |
|
| The subject of offshore outsourcing continues to be highly controversial because it is an emotionally charged subject that is not well understood by many companies in first world economies. While the notion of moving large Front Office and Back Office contracts offshore is acknowledged as challenging for business to embrace, it is vital to the interests of the first world economies that businesses there participate in an educated, strategic and sophisticated level of debate on the subject.

Jobs growth not the only winner from BPO in The Philippines
The property sector in the Philippines is rising from the doldrums thanks to the booming business process outsourcing (BPO) industry. Aside from boosting the country's labor, another clear beneficiary of the boom in the BPO industry is the property sector.
Business process outsourcing or BPO is an emerging industry in the Philippines. The industry itself was regarded as one of the fastest growing industry in the world. The phenomenal BPO boom is led by demand for offshore call centers. It is estimated that over 112,000 people were working in call centers in the Philippines in 2005, bringing in revenues of US$1.12 billion for the year. This is in sharp contrast to 2000 when Filipino call centers employed 2400 people and earned US$24 million. |
